Stephan Alan Comstock Sr., 48, a native of Baldwin County and a resident of Loxley died Oct. 30, 1991.
He is survived by his wife, Paulette Comstock of Loxley; a daughter, Stephanie Alisha Comstock of Loxley; three sons; Stephen Alan Comstock Jr., of Loxley, William Michael Comstock of Robertsdale, and Richard Aaron Comstock of Loxley; mother, Georgia McMillian of Loxley, father, John R. Comstock, Magnolia Springs; six sisters: Gloria Murphy of Loxley, Sandra Ray of Gulf Shores, Deborah Henson of Bay Minette, Judy Powell of Robertsdale, Donna Falcon and Laura Collins both of Pierre, S.C.; two brothers, John R. Comstock Jr., and Sidney McMillian of Loxley; and two grandchildren.
Funeral services were held Nov. 1 from the Rosinton United Methodist Church with the Rev. Steve Rascoe officiating. Burial was in the Greenwood Cemetery, Loxley. Arrangements were by Mack Funeral Home Inc., Robertsdale.
Published Thursday, November 7, 1991, The Independent, Robertsdale, Alabama Page 5B
